Meghan Markle Takes Strategic Step for Future as Prince Harry Remains in Canada

Meghan Markle is making waves behind the scenes as the Duchess of Sussex shifts her focus to individual projects, leaving Prince Harry to continue his solo commitments at the Invictus Games in Canada. While the couple made a joint appearance during the first few days of the event in Vancouver and Whistler, Meghan is now set to return to California to reunite with their children, Prince Archie, 5, and Princess Lilibet, 3.

Before stepping out to support Harry at the Invictus Games, rumors surfaced that Meghan was considering writing a book about divorce—not about her first husband, Trevor Engelson, but allegedly about her relationship with Prince Harry. Meghan and Engelson divorced in 2013 after two years of marriage. Reports suggested her team had reached out to publishers to gauge interest in the project, though sources later denied any finalized plans. Some insiders even dismissed the claims, stating that publishers would have approached Meghan, not the other way around.

While the divorce book may not be in the works, Meghan appears to be leveraging her personal experiences to forge new connections in Hollywood. Recently, the Duchess attended Kerry Washington’s birthday party, where she reportedly bonded with Jessica Alba, who recently ended her 20-year marriage. According to *Closer Magazine*, Meghan and Jessica connected over shared experiences, discussing their marriages and personal journeys.

“Meghan was very excited about going to Kerry’s birthday celebration—mainly at the thought of befriending her A-list pals, knowing how well-connected she is in Hollywood,” an insider revealed. The source added that Meghan’s A-list friendship circle has been “rapidly declining,” and she hopes her new connection with Jessica will open doors to other high-profile friendships, including with stars like Kate Hudson and Jennifer Garner.

As Meghan works to maintain her Hollywood star status, her strategic networking efforts highlight her determination to stay relevant in the entertainment industry. Meanwhile, Prince Harry remains in Canada, continuing his passionate support for the Invictus Games, an event he founded to honor wounded veterans.

The couple’s separate paths underscore their evolving roles as they balance family life, individual projects, and public commitments. While Meghan focuses on building her Hollywood connections, Harry remains dedicated to his philanthropic endeavors, showcasing their ability to navigate both personal and professional challenges.
